Output bec46fa6594ed822a51890631fdb512d012b3fd3910f2ce31486c2c150e50f93:2

value
65172598
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c45b11bb57380c66258ac94507839a216b877905 OP_EQUALVERIFY OP_CHECKSIG
address
1JuEYCjFLwsQt98yQiKyKeKaNTtv2Ga77q
transaction
bec46fa6594ed822a51890631fdb512d012b3fd3910f2ce31486c2c150e50f93
spent
true